Kelly Osbourne Released From Miami Hospital After Head Injury

MIAMI (CBSMiami/AP) — Reality star Kelly Osbourne was probably seeing stars after being treated for a head injury in Miami.

Osbourne was admitted to Mercy Hospital and released on Monday, according to Osbourne who tweeted about the incident.

The 27-year-old E! Fashion Police co-host wrote on Twitter that she "cracked" her head open "then kept passing out." She said she was given the "all clear" and was released from Mercy Hospital, which declined comment Monday.

Osbourne was attending a model casting call for Madonna's Material Girl clothing line while in Miami. Her publicist has not yet released the cause of the injury.

Pictures on her Twitter page show she was at a club Saturday night.

Osbourne found fame after appearing on the reality series "The Osbournes" alongside her family, including rock star Ozzy Osbourne. She has recorded several albums and appeared on "Dancing with the Stars" in 2009.
